STM32F401VE and boot mode

Question asked by Kraal on Jun 21, 2017


I've purchased the STEVAL-3DP001V1 board from ST, which is powered by a STM32F401VE. There is a jumper called boot which is wired as follow:

So the pin BOOT0 is normally held high when the jumper is not fitted. BOOT1 is PB2 which is tied to ground.

According to the F401 user manual, the uC will boot from system memory when the jumper is not fitted, and from main flash memory when fitted.

My question is: what happens once the uC has boot in system memory ? Will it stay there forever, waiting for stimuli on any of the enabled communication peripherals ?